Looks like another ASI radiator rebranded similar to the Godspeed or Haste radiators. I'm very sure they come from the same suppliers and if you look closely at the bottom tank you will see there is no nipple or return line to the AST which makes it pretty difficult. Whether they've fixed this problem or not I am not certain.

As for ease of installation, try looking up the thread on the Haste radiator and you will see that they are a pain to install as things don't line up.

If I were you I'd stay stick to the more well known such as Koyo or Fluidyne.
